Ep 17. The Hawaii Department of Agriculture with Chairperson Phyllis Shimabukuro-Geiser
Manage episode 336656850 series 3000240
In this episode we talk with Phyllis Shimabukuro-Geiser, Chair of the Hawaii Department of Agriculture, about how the Department has worked supporting agriculture producers during COVID and with lands managed by the Department for producers. She also highlights key issues the Department faces, ways all of us can impact change, and some thoughts on the future of agriculture in Hawaii.
